I quit 3 years ago on my 30th birthday, purely out of vanity. I had smoked a pack a day for 10 years. Most of my friends had quit and I didn't want to be one of those old ladies with prune face and hands, yellow finger nails, and the Marg Simpson voice. I had done some programs and the patch and all that stuff. But picking a signifigant day and just forbidding myself worked for me. Cold turkey. I maybe had three cheat cigs after that date, and I didn't even enjoy them. Everyone is different though.
It's weird now that after all those years of happily smoking, the smell of cig smoke now makes me sick and I couldn't even imagine sticking one in my mouth. And I LOVED smoking. Three years later, I'm so glad I did it! Especailly since they cost $10.50 in NY now!
